The Coffee-and-Bones Study Behind the Scary Headline Found No Significant Coffee Effect
The tea benefit was 0.003 grams per square centimeter, a number the authors themselves called too small to matter. The scary coffee result never cleared statistical significance.

Nutrition & FoodBrewed tea has the longevity receipts. The supplement aisle has a liver problem.
A 2025 review finds 1.5 to 2 cups of brewed tea daily correlate with about 10% lower all-cause and 14% lower cardiovascular mortality. The EGCG-extract supplements built on the same chemistry have been linked to over 100 liver-injury cases, while bubble tea can match a Coke for sugar.
